CostParams

constructor(carryingRate: Double = 0.1, backorderRate: Double = 0.0, orderingCost: Double = 5.5, unloadingCost: Double = 30.0, loadingCost: Double = 40.0, shippingCost: Double = 15.0, stockoutCost: Double = 0.0, lostSaleCost: Double = 0.0, unitShortageCost: Double = 0.0, esLoadingCost: Double = 40.0)(source)

Parameters

carryingRate

continuous-rate inventory carrying rate per unit per (modeler-chosen time unit). Multiplies the time-weighted on-hand and on-order averages.

backorderRate

continuous-rate backlog carrying rate per unit per (modeler-chosen time unit). Multiplies the time-weighted backlog average. Default 0.0 disables the continuous backorder-cost line.

orderingCost

$ per replenishment-order event.

unloadingCost

$ per inbound shipment.

loadingCost

$ per outbound shipment.

shippingCost

$ per outbound shipment.

stockoutCost

$ per stockout event.

lostSaleCost

$ per lost-sale event.

unitShortageCost

$ per unit short.

esLoadingCost

$ per outbound shipment from the external supplier.